ANDOVER, Minn. -
Chaska (Minn.) saw its 14-point lead shrink to one, but hung on to upset
Andover (Minn.) 21-20 on Saturday.
After taking the lead on a touchdown run by
Kolby Seiffert in the first quarter, the Hawks led 13-7 at the half.
Chaska grew its lead to seven points entering the fourth quarter. CHS scored two times in the third, including once on a touchdown pass by
Justin Arnold to
Calvin Buesgens.
With the win the Hawks extended their winning streak to 11 games. Chaska defeated Mankato West 27-6 last week.
The defeat comes as a step back for Andover, who notched a 33-32 victory over Spring Lake Park in its previous outing. The loss snapped Andover's three-game winning streak.
